Taha Hussein Life story


Taha Hussein was one of the most influential 20th-century Egyptian writers and intellectuals, and a figurehead for the Arab Renaissance and the modernist movement in the Arab world. His sobriquet was "The Dean of Arabic Literature". He was nominated for the Nobel Prize in Literature twenty-one times.
